Overview of the Hike
The Nagarkot Bhaktapur Hike takes trekkers on a captivating journey through the scenic landscapes surrounding Kathmandu.
This full-day excursion begins in the picturesque village of Nagarkot, known for its stunning views of the Himalayan range.
From there, hikers will embark on a moderate trek, passing through quaint Nepalese villages and lush forests, before arriving at the historic city of Bhaktapur.
Along the way, they’ll have the opportunity to witness local cultural traditions and savor a delicious lunch.
The hike concludes back at the starting point in Nagarkot, providing participants with a well-rounded experience of Nepal’s natural beauty and rich cultural heritage.

Frequently Asked Questions
What Is the Best Time of Year to Do This Hike?
The best time to do this hike is typically during the spring and autumn seasons. The weather is mild and pleasant, with clear visibility for scenic views. Hikers should avoid the hot, humid summers and cold, snowy winters for the most comfortable experience.
How Difficult Is the Terrain on This Hike?
The terrain on this hike is moderate, requiring a moderate level of physical fitness. There are some steep ascents and descents, but the paths are generally well-maintained and manageable for most hikers with proper footwear and preparation.
Are Hiking Poles Recommended for This Trail?
Hiking poles are generally recommended for this moderate hike due to the terrain’s uneven and sometimes steep nature. They can provide extra stability and support, especially on descents, making the experience more comfortable and easier for hikers.
